Where can I find the block heater on a Toyota Corolla?

To set up a block heater for a Toyota Corolla, it should be placed in the engine compartment below the air filter box, closer to the rear near the shifter bolts. The heater's wires can then be passed through the compartment towards the front grille for connecting. Toyota offers an original kit made specifically for adjusting vehicles to accommodate a block heater. These are commonly used in colder regions where extremely low temperatures can pose challenges in starting the vehicle or put additional strain on the engine. By plugging in the block heater a few hours before starting the car, drivers can effectively warm up both the engine and its fluids, ensuring a smoother drive and prolonging the vehicle's lifespan during harsh weather conditions.
